
BOCA RATON, FL (BocaNewsNow.com) (Copyright © 2024 MetroDesk Media, LLC) — If you like the cool weather, you have a few more days to enjoy it — then it likely won’t back until 2025. Like a radio station trying to play anything to get people to listen, we’re heading back into the 60s, 70s, and 80s.
The National Weather Service forecast for Boca Raton, Delray Beach, Boynton Beach, Lake Worth Beach, Wellington and South Palm Beach County is calling for a low Friday night around 62, then a high Saturday near 75. Saturday night expect a low around 63 and a high Sunday around 75.
The low Sunday night should be around 70 with a high Monday 80. Monday night expect a low around 70 and a high again on Tuesday of 80. There’s a chance of rain on Wednesday with a high near 82.
Thursday and Friday — if you believe a forecast that’s nearly a week out — expect highs in the mid to upper 70s and lows around 70. There is no heavy rain in the forecast.
